Baseball is a very high skill requiring sport. It is the only sport with an extensive minor league system. The reason for that is because there are so many aspects of the game that a player needs to hone his skills to be able to compete in such a comPetitive sport.
Also it is very physically demanding as players need to have speed and quickness and reflexes when playing the field. Just watch an outfielder chase down a fly ball 50 feet+ and dive to catch a ball traveling at fast speed.
Baseball is definitely a sport!!
